Navigating the French Rental Market: Expert Tips
The French rental market can be competitive. Here are a few tips to increase your chances of success:
- Prepare Your Dossier: Landlords typically require a comprehensive dossier including proof of income, identification, and potentially a guarantor.
- Be Responsive: Respond quickly to inquiries and be prepared to schedule viewings promptly.
- Understand the Costs: Factor in not only the rent and charges but also agency fees and potential insurance costs.
- Familiarize Yourself with French Rental Laws: Knowing your rights as a tenant is crucial.
